Landscaping business opens
Pine Island Chamber of Commerce Executive Director Jennifer Jennings and business owner Juan Castaneda cut the ribbon last week to celebrate the grand opening of J.M.C. Landscaping LLC.
The new business is located between Dairy Queen and Stonegate Bank just south of the center on Stringfellow Road. Juan Castaneda is just 19 years old.
“This ribbon-cutting ceremony for J.M.C. marks the launch of a new era for their business and we are happy to celebrate and be part of their grand opening,” Jennings said. “The Board of Directors and staff wish them the best of luck in their new endeavor.”
“I’ve always enjoyed landscaping and growing things,” Castaneda said. “This is a dream come true for me to get this business up and running.”
J.M.C. Is a full-service operation.
“We specialize in palms,” Casteneda said. “My father and I grow palms here on the island and all of the palms I sell come from our land.”
Castaneda also has tropical fruit trees, bamboo and shrubs, as well as offering garden and landscaping care and maintenance.
“We also offer landscaping delivery and installation, fertilizing, trimming, tree removal, herbiciding, irrigation installation and seasonal cleanups,” Castaneda said. “We can provide various materials such as rock, shell, mulch, fill dirt and sod. If you don’t see it be sure to ask.”
“This is a very satisfying business for me,” Casteneda said. “When people are excited and happy with the outcome it makes all the hard work worth it.”
